Osteoporosis

Consumption of driedplumsexerts anabolic and anti resorptive actions, which aid in maintaining healthy bones. Flavonoids such as caffeic acid and rutin that are both present in plums help in inhibiting the deterioration of bone tissues and prevent diseases such as osteoporosis inpostmenopausalwomen. Polyphenols, along with the potassium content present in dried plums, encourage the formation of bones, enhances bone density and prevents bone loss caused by ovarian hormone deficiency.Researchhas demonstrated that regular consumption of dried plums helps in the restoration of bone density that has already been lost due to aging.
